RASYS ;HISC/CAH AISC/TMP-System Definition Menu ;11/13/96 14:17
Source file <RASYS.m>
| Package | Total | Caller Graph |
|---|---|---|
| Radiology Nuclear Medicine | 9 | RA RESOURCE DEVICE RA SITEACCNUM RA SYSDIV RA SYSDIVLIST RA SYSEXLIST RA SYSEXROOM RA SYSLOC RA SYSLOCLIST RASYS |
| Name | Comments | DBIA/ICR reference |
|---|---|---|
| Q1 | ||
| KILL5 | ||
| NOLOC | ;print camera/equip/rm's not assigned to any imaging loc
|
|
| END | ;
|
|
| KILL3 | ||
| QRDEV | ||
| INA(RAD0) | ; Determine if an Imaging Location is inactive.
; Input : 'RAD0' ien of file 79.1 ; Output: '1' if the location is valid, '0' if invalid |
|
| 1 | ;;Division Parameter Set-up
|
|
| ZIS(RA) | ; Select a device.
; 'RAPOP'=device selection successful (1:no) ^ '^%ZTLOAD' called (1:yes) |
|
| 3 | ;;Location Parameter Set-up
|
|
| 2 | ;;Print Division Parameter List
|
|
| 5 | ;;Camera/Equip/Room Entry/Edit
|
|
| 4 | ;;Imaging Location Parameter List
|
|
| RDEV | ; Select a Resource Device for a division. This subroutine is linked
; directly to the option: RA RESOURCE DEVICE. This option is a menu ; item under the RA SITEMANAGER menu option. |
|
| 6 | ;;List of Camera/Equip/Rooms
|
|
| ENTASK | ; Entry point for the tasked job.
|
|
| KILL | ; Kill and quit
|
|
| INACT | ; write inactive flag, called by 'List of Camera/Equip/Rms' option
|
|
| SACNPAR | ; Site (long) Accession Number Parameter Entry/Edit
|
|
| RDEVHLP | ; Display the Description Text for the Resource Device (#100) field
; on the Rad/Nuc Med Division file. |
|
| ZTSAVE | ; Save off variables for the tasked job.
|
| Name | Field # of Occurrence |
|---|---|
| ^%ZIS | ZIS+3 |
| HOME^%ZIS | 1+5, 3+6, 4+14, ZIS+9 |
| ^%ZTLOAD | ZIS+7 |
| ^DIC | 1+2, 3+2, 5+1, RDEV+4 |
| FIELD^DID | RDEVHLP+2 |
| ^DIE | 1+3, 3+5, 5+2, RDEV+5, SACNPAR+19 |
| EN1^DIP | 2+1, 6+2, ENTASK+3 |
| ^DIR | 4+6, SACNPAR+13 |
| KILL^RASYS | ENTASK+4 |
| EN1^RASYS1 | 1+7, 3+6 |
| $$LOC^RAUTL12 | 4+9 |
| $$XTERNAL^RAUTL5 | INA+4 |
| Name | Line Occurrences |
|---|---|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Routine Call |
|
| Routine Call |
|
| Routine Call |
|
| Routine Call |
|
| Routine Call |
|
| FileNo | Call Tags |
|---|---|
| ^RA(78.6 - [#78.6] | Classic Fileman Calls |
| ^RA(79 - [#79] | Classic Fileman Calls, FIELD^DID |
| ^RA(79.1 - [#79.1] | Classic Fileman Calls |
| Name | Line Occurrences (* Changed, ! Killed) |
|---|---|
| ^DD(79.1 | INA+4 |
| ^RA(78.6 - [#78.6] | NOLOC+3, NOLOC+8, INACT+2, INACT+3 |
| ^RA(79 - [#79] | 1+4, 1+6, 1+7, SACNPAR+11, SACNPAR+17 |
| ^RA(79.1 - [#79.1] | INA+3, NOLOC+4, NOLOC+5 |
| ^TMP($J | INA+5, KILL+1!, ZTSAVE+4 |
| Name | Line Occurrences |
|---|---|
| $$ZIS | 4+13 |
| 1 | 1+10 |
| 3 | 3+6 |
| 5 | 5+2 |
| ENTASK | 4+16 |
| KILL | 4+7, 4+9, 4+14, 4+15 |
| KILL3 | 3+2, 3+6 |
| KILL5 | 5+1, 5+2 |
| Q1 | 1+2, 1+10 |
| QRDEV | RDEV+5 |
| ZTSAVE | ZIS+7 |
| Name | Field # of Occurrence |
|---|---|
| ^(0 | INACT+3 |
| >> | Not killed explicitly |
| * | Changed |
| ! | Killed |
| ~ | Newed |
| Name | Field # of Occurrence |
|---|---|
| % | 1+10!, KILL3!, 5+2!, RDEV+3~ |
| %W | KILL3! |
| %X | 1+10!, KILL3!, KILL+1!, RDEV+3~ |
| %XX | KILL+1! |
| %Y | 1+10!, KILL3!, KILL+1!, RDEV+3~ |
| %YY | KILL+1! |
| %ZIS | KILL+2!, ZIS+2!* |
| %ZIS("A" | ZIS+3* |
| %ZIS("HFSMODE" | ENTASK+2* |
| %ZIS("HFSNAME" | ENTASK+2* |
| BY | 2+1*!, 4+11*, 6+1*, 6+3!, KILL+2! |
| C | 1+10!, KILL3+1!, RDEV+3~ |
| D | Q1!, KILL3!, KILL5!, RDEV+3~ |
| D0 | 1+10!, KILL3!, 5+2!, INA+3, INA+5, RDEV+3~ |
| DA | 1+3*, 1+4, 1+6, 1+7, 1+10!, 3+5*, 3+6, KILL3!, 5+2*!, RDEV+3~ , RDEV+5*, SACNPAR+18*, END+1! |
| DDC | Q1! |
| >> DDDD0 | INACT+1, INACT+2, INACT+4 |
| DDER | RDEV+3~ |
| DDH | KILL3+1!, RDEV+3~ |
| DE | 1+10!, KILL3!, 5+2! |
| DG | Q1!, KILL5! |
| DHD | 2+1!, 6+3!, KILL+2!, ZTSAVE+3 |
| DI | Q1!, KILL3+1!, KILL5!, RDEV+3~ |
| DIC | 1+1*, 1+2!, 2+1*, 3+1*, 3+2!, 4+11*, 5+1*!, 6+1*, KILL+2!, RDEV+3~* , END+1! |
| DIC("A" | 1+1*, 3+1*, 5+1*, RDEV+4* |
| DIC(0 | 1+1*, 3+1*, 5+1*, RDEV+4* |
| DIE | 1+3*, 1+10!, 3+5*, KILL3!, 5+2*!, RDEV+3~*, SACNPAR+18*, END+1! |
| DIG | Q1!, KILL3+1! |
| DIH | Q1!, KILL3+1! |
| DIOEND | 6+2*, 6+3! |
| DIR | 4+1!, 4+7! |
| DIR("?" | 4+4*, 4+5*, SACNPAR+14* |
| DIR("A" | 4+3*, SACNPAR+13* |
| DIR("B" | 4+2* |
| DIR(0 | 4+2*, SACNPAR+13* |
| DIROUT | 4+1!, 4+7! |
| DIRUT | 4+1!, 4+6, 4+7!, SACNPAR+15 |
| DIS | KILL+2!, ZTSAVE+2 |
| DIS(0 | 4+12* |
| DISYS | Q1!, KILL3+1!, KILL5!, QRDEV! |
| DIU | Q1!, KILL3+1! |
| DIV | Q1!, KILL3! |
| DIW | Q1!, KILL3+1! |
| DIWI | KILL3+1! |
| DLAYGO | 1+1*, 1+2!, 3+1*, 3+2!, 5+1*! |
| DQ | 1+10!, KILL3!, 5+2!, RDEV+3~ |
| DR | 1+3*, 1+10!, 3+5*, KILL3!, 5+2*!, RDEV+3~, RDEV+5*, SACNPAR+18*, END+1! |
| DST | Q1!, QRDEV! |
| DTOUT | 4+1!, 4+7!, KILL+2!, END+1! |
| DUOUT | Q1!, 4+1!, 4+7!, KILL+2!, END+1! |
| E | KILL3! |
| FLDS | 2+1*!, 6+3!, KILL+2! |
| FR | 2+1*!, 6+3!, KILL+2! |
| I | Q1!, KILL3+1!, KILL5!, KILL+3!, ZTSAVE+1~*, QRDEV! |
| IO | ENTASK+2 |
| IO("Q" | ZIS+5, ZIS+6! |
| IOF | 1+5, 3+6 |
| IOM | ENTASK+1 |
| ION | ENTASK+1 |
| IOP | ENTASK+1*, ENTASK+2, ZIS+2! |
| IOSL | ENTASK+1 |
| IOST | ENTASK+1 |
| J | Q1! |
| L | 2+1*, 4+11*, 6+1*, KILL+2! |
| POP | Q1!, KILL3+1!, KILL5!, 6+3!, KILL+2!, KILL+3!, ZIS+4, QRDEV! |
| R1 | NOLOC+2~, NOLOC+3*, NOLOC+5*, NOLOC+6, NOLOC+7*, NOLOC+8 |
| R2 | NOLOC+2~, NOLOC+4*, NOLOC+5 |
| R3 | NOLOC+2~, NOLOC+4*, NOLOC+5 |
| R4 | NOLOC+2~*, NOLOC+8* |
| RA | ZIS~, ZIS+6 |
| RA1 | INACT+2~*, INACT+3 |
| RA100DES | RDEVHLP+2~ |
| RA100DES("DESCRIPTION" | RDEVHLP+3, RDEVHLP+4, RDEVHLP+5 |
| RA2 | INACT+2~*, INACT+3*, INACT+4 |
| RA791 | INA+3~*, INA+4 |
| RA791(1 | INA+4*, INA+5 |
| RACAM | NOLOC+2~ |
| RACAM( | NOLOC+3*, NOLOC+6!, NOLOC+7 |
| RAD0 | INA~ |
| RADA | SACNPAR+18*, END+1! |
| RAFLH | KILL3! |
| RAINA | 4+1~*, 4+6*, 4+7, 4+8*, 4+9, KILL+2! |
| RAINC | 1+5*, 1+6*, 1+7, 1+10! |
| RAIOP | ENTASK+1*, KILL+2! |
| RAJAC | KILL3! |
| RALERT | KILL3+1! |
| RALINE | KILL3+1! |
| RANOLOC | 6+3!, NOLOC+1, NOLOC+9* |
| RAPOP | 4+13*, 4+14, 4+15, KILL+2!, ZIS+4*, ZIS+5, ZIS+7*, ZIS+11 |
| RAREQPRT | KILL3! |
| RARPT | KILL3! |
| RAVAL | SACNPAR+11~*, SACNPAR+12 |
| RAX | 4+9~* |
| RAXIT | 1+3*, 1+6, 1+10!, 3+5*, KILL3! |
| RAY | 4+9~, 4+10*, 4+13 |
| RAZVAL | SACNPAR+16~* |
| >> RAZZDIV | SACNPAR+17*, SACNPAR+18 |
| TO | 2+1*!, 6+3!, KILL+2! |
| U | 3+3, 3+4, NOLOC+8, INACT+3 |
| X | 1+2!, KILL3!, 5+1!, 5+2!, KILL+3!, RDEV+3~, END+1! |
| Y | 1+2!, 1+3, 3+2, 3+3, 3+4, 3+5, KILL3!, 4+8, 5+1!, 5+2! , KILL+3!, RDEV+3~, RDEV+5, SACNPAR+16, END+1! |
| Y(0 | 3+4 |
| Z | RDEVHLP+2~*, RDEVHLP+4*, RDEVHLP+5 |
| ZTDESC | KILL+3!, ZIS+6* |
| ZTRTN | KILL+3!, ZIS+6* |
| ZTSAVE | KILL+3! |
| ZTSAVE( | ZTSAVE+1* |
| ZTSAVE("DHD" | ZTSAVE+3* |
| ZTSAVE("DIS(" | ZTSAVE+2* |
| ZTSAVE("^TMP( | $J, ""RA L-TYPE"", " , ZTSAVE+4* |
| >> ZTSK | ZIS+8 |